I posted most of this on the main thread, but here goes:

I arrived at the polling place in Allegheny County (Western suburb) at about 10 minutes to 7 this morning, and was shocked to see a line of about 50 people there already. This has never happened before. Talked to a few people in line who either requested a mail in ballot and never received it, or didn’t trust mail-in ballots. I tend to assume those who distrust VBM are Trump voters, but you never know. The guy who didn’t get his mail-in ballot sarcastically said they were probably saving it for Biden.

They brought us in in small groups, and I entered at about 7:15. When I went up to the desk, the young woman checking us in couldn’t find my name on the list at first; looking in the wrong part of the alphabet no doubt. Then they handed me a paper ballot! I have used voting machines at that polling place for seven years. Possibly because of COVID. Anyway, I filled it out and put it in a scanning machine. I hope it took. When my BF voted in another county (Washington), the machine gave him a printed receipt.

As I was leaving, a young (30s-ish) woman was outside placing Republican political signs in the grass around the polling location (they gave her permission to do so). That was somewhat encouraging to me, as I tend to stereotype millennials as being Democrats.
